About Royal Flying Doctor Service South Australia & Northern Territory (RFDS SA/NT)

Australia’s most trusted charity Royal Flying Doctor Service provides 24-hour emergency aeromedical and primary health care services to those who live, work and travel in rural and remote Australia.

Serving South Australia and the Northern Territory, the team at RFDS SA/NT exists to support happier and healthier Australians no matter where they live, work or play.

About this Opportunity

Our Darwin Tourist Facility provides an opportunity for the public to learn about the history, staff, and patients of the Royal Flying Doctor Service and their heroic stories, in a technology driven and interactive environment.

Reporting to the Tourism Manager NT, the Tourist Facility Manager is responsible for the achievement of annual admissions and operating revenue (net profit) targets set for the Darwin RFDS Tourist Facility, including the development and stewardship of the overall marketing and retail business plans for the Facility and their implementation by Tourist Facility staff. 

This integral role specifically involves:

• Effective and efficient operation of the Darwin Tourist Facility.
• Meeting set KPI targets in consultation with the Tourism Manager NT.
• Development and stewardship of digital and retail business plans and their implementation by Tourist Facility staff.
• Supervision of Tourist Facility staff, meeting mandatory training requirements, and the maintaining of appropriate staffing levels through rostering and recruitment;
• Enhancing and protecting the RFDS brand, image and reputation throughout Darwin and the Top End, and aid planning, preparation and facilitation of approved RFDS fundraising activities.
